About This Item

New York: Harmony Books (Crown), 1986 WYSIWYG pricing--no added shipping charge for standard shipping within USA. Quarter dark grey cloth, grey paper-covered boards, blue foil titles on spine, blue endpapers, 239 pp, b & w photos on most pages. A bit of wear just visible on one corner of DJ, else fine in Brodart archival cover. Hundreds of wonderful street scenes illustrate this popular history of life in Brooklyn by the official Borough Historian. Shipping weight 3 lbs.. 5th ptg. . Fine/Near Fine. 24 X 20 cm.
